As3.js 是一種用于在 Web 瀏覽器中創建交互式 Web 應用程序的 JavaScript 庫。與常見的 CSS 樣式表不同,As3.js 使用 As3 語言編寫,因此需要使用 As3 語言編寫的代碼來控制樣式表。
在 As3.js 中,可以使用內置的樣式屬性來控制元素的樣式,也可以使用內置的樣式函數來定義元素的樣式。例如,可以使用 `style` 屬性來定義一個元素的樣式,如下所示:
<div style="width: 300px; height: 200px; background-color: red;">
<p>Hello, World!</p>
</div>
在這個例子中,`style` 屬性定義了 div 元素的寬和高,背景顏色為紅色。
除了內置的樣式屬性和函數外,As3.js 還提供了一些高級功能,例如動態修改樣式、樣式輪播、樣式聚合等,這些功能可以幫助開發人員更加靈活地控制元素的樣式。
下面是一個使用 As3.js 動態修改樣式的例子:
var element = document.getElementById("myDiv");
element.style.width = "600px";
在這個例子中,我們使用 `getElementById` 方法獲取了一個名為 "myDiv" 的 div 元素,然后使用 `style.width` 屬性來修改元素的width屬性。
此外,As3.js 還提供了一些內置的函數和對象,可以用于定義和操作元素的樣式。例如,可以使用 `style.color` 函數來設置元素的文本顏色,如下所示:
<div style="color: blue;">
<p>Hello, World!</p>
</div>
在這個例子中,`style.color` 函數設置了 div 元素的文本顏色為藍色。
總之,As3.js 提供了豐富的樣式控制能力,可以用于創建交互式 Web 應用程序。開發人員可以使用內置的樣式屬性和函數來控制元素的樣式,也可以使用 As3.js 提供的高級功能來更加靈活地控制元素的樣式。